The British royal family has had many disagreements in recent years, but all old grudges must be forgotten.
This was the Queen's order.
The British edition of the Daily Mail claims that Her Majesty urged relatives not to make a drama during the celebration of her Platinum Jubilee. Apparently, the monarch's appeal was primarily addressed to her grandson Harry and his wife Meghan Markle, as well as Prince Charles and Prince William, whose resentment against the red-haired Duke is still upsetting Elizabeth II.
According to insiders, the Sussex couple has vowed to behave with restraint and not draw public attention. However, Buckingham Palace officials are convinced that on 4 June, when daughters of Harry and Meghan will be one year old, "rebellious" members of the Royal family will still not be able to restrain themselves from "pulling the blanket over themselves" in the official celebrations.
